Yes -- Fiorella is the #2706 most popular girls' name in the U.S. today, with 1,639 recorded since 1974.
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Fiorella has been recorded 1,639 times among girls since 1974, currently ranked #2706 nationally and more common than 85% of girls, with its heaviest use in the 2000s. This profile covers year-by-year birth trends, decade totals, and state-level distribution, all derived directly from SSA birth-registration files spanning 1974 to 2025.

How the numbers stack up
Fiorella's all-time total is 4x the median girls name, and Olivia still leads by a wide margin.
| Metric | Fiorella | Median girls name (Emerly) | #1 girls name (Olivia) |
|---|---|---|---|
| All-time total births | 1,639 | 382 | 567,345 |
| Peak-year births | 90 | 48 | 19,840 |
Fiorella's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Fiorella's full recorded timeline at 2004, 77%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 23% in the earlier half -- usage has skewed toward the present, not a one-decade spike. Its quietest year on record was 1974,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 2025 peak of 90 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Fiorella by state
Where Fiorella concentrates geographically, total births since 1974
| Rank | State | Visual share | Births | Share of total |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| #1 | Florida | | 343 | 20.9% |
| #2 | California | | 206 | 12.6% |
| #3 | New York | | 143 | 8.7% |
| #4 | Texas | | 132 | 8.1% |
| #5 | New Jersey | | 69 | 4.2% |
| #6 | Virginia | | 12 | 0.7% |
| #7 | Maryland | | 5 | 0.3% |
| #8 | Michigan | | 5 | 0.3% |
343 of 1,639 births nationwide. Compared to a flat distribution across 8 reporting states.
